A bag contains 10 blue, 6 red, and 4 green rubber balls. If you select a ball
at random from the bag, what is the probability of not choosing a green ball? 

A. 1/5 
B. 4/5
C. 5/6
D. 9/10 

To not choose a green ball means to select a non-green ball.  There are
16 non-green balls out of the 20. So the probability is 16/20 which reduces
to 4/5, so the correct answer is B.

----------------------------------------------------------

Why can you eliminate choice D in this question?

Because that's what the answer would be if there had been 10 blue, 8 red,
and 2 green rubber balls.
